The brief
Current coverage indicates a broad shift in the application and perception of GLP-1 medications. A report from USA Today describes a specialized GLP-1 retreat that altered a participant's perspective on the weight loss process, suggesting a move toward integrated wellness experiences. Simultaneously, Medical Xpress reports on a meta-analysis showing that drugs similar to Ozempic offer systemic benefits to the body that extend beyond the primary goal of weight reduction. These developments reflect a diversifying landscape of how these pharmacological interventions are being integrated into healthcare and lifestyle routines across different demographics. Several outlets are focusing on the specific populations and psychological factors surrounding these drugs. Medical Xpress has highlighted a study finding that GLP-1 use is rising rapidly among adolescents and young adults in the United States.
Meanwhile, Healio is emphasizing the psychological dimensions of the crisis, specifically exploring the impact of weight stigma on patients living with obesity. These reports from Medical Xpress and Healio suggest that the medical community is increasingly concerned with both the age of patients initiating treatment and the mental health burdens that accompany the physical journey of weight loss. Quick answers
Who is increasingly using GLP-1 drugs according to recent studies?
Medical Xpress reports that use is rising rapidly among adolescents and young adults in the United States.
Do GLP-1 medications offer benefits other than weight loss?
Yes, a meta-analysis cited by Medical Xpress shows that Ozempic-like drugs provide more benefits to the body than just weight loss.
What psychological factor is being examined in relation to obesity patients?
Healio is focusing on the psychological impact of weight stigma on patients with obesity.
